Jonathan Kuminga has reached an agreement with the Minnesota Timberwolves, according to league reports, reshaping the Western Conference landscape as the talented forward transitions to a new franchise. The transaction introduces immediate roster adjustments for Minnesota as the team integrates a dynamic young scorer into its rotation.

Evaluating the Strategic Fit on the Court
Tactical adjustments will follow quickly as coaching staff figure out optimal lineup combinations. Jonathan Kuminga brings transition speed and isolation scoring that can relieve pressure on primary playmakers. Analysts point out that defensive versatility remains a core requirement in Minnesota’s scheme, making Kuminga’s physical profile a logical fit for head coach Chris Finch’s system. Opposing defenses must now account for another dynamic slasher when preparing game plans against the Timberwolves.
